Genetics. Sickle cell anaemia is caused by a mutation in a gene called haemoglobin beta (HBB), located on chromosome 11.; It is a recessive genetic disease, which means that both copies of the gene must contain the mutation for a person to have sickle cell anaemia.; If an individual has just one copy of the mutated gene they are said to be a carrier of the sickle cell trait.
